Job Description
We are seeking a professional and customer-focused Catering Server to join our team in Victoria, Canada. In this role, you will be the face of our catering organization, delivering exceptional service to guests at various events and functions. As a Catering Server, you will work in a dynamic, fast-paced environment where attention to detail, efficiency, and a friendly demeanor are essential. You will be responsible for ensuring every guest receives outstanding service while maintaining the highest standards of professionalism and food safety.
- Provide courteous and efficient food and beverage service to guests at catering events, banquets, and functions
- Set up and clear tables according to established service standards and event specifications
- Take guest orders accurately and communicate them to kitchen and bar staff
- Deliver food and beverages to guests in a timely and professional manner, ensuring proper presentation
- Maintain knowledge of menu items, ingredients, and preparation methods to answer guest questions
- Monitor guest satisfaction throughout the event and respond promptly to requests or concerns
- Adhere to all food safety and hygiene protocols to ensure guest health and safety
- Collaborate with team members to coordinate service flow and support colleagues during busy periods
- Handle cash and payment transactions accurately when required
- Clean and sanitize service areas, equipment, and utensils according to organizational standards
- Adapt to changing event requirements and guest needs with flexibility and professionalism
